37-1241.04. Personal watercraft; manner of operation.

(1) A person shall operate a personal watercraft on the waters of this state in a reasonable and prudent manner. A maneuver which unreasonably or unnecessarily endangers life, limb, or property is prohibited and includes weaving through congested vessel traffic, jumping the wake produced by another vessel at a distance of less than fifty yards, or jumping the wake produced by a motorboat or personal watercraft that is towing a person or persons.

(2) A person shall not operate a personal watercraft on the waters of this state unless he or she is facing forward on the watercraft.

Source:Laws 1999, LB 176, § 105; Laws 2003, LB 305, § 21.
